>From what I read in the manual the tone option is available with the USA and Australia versions only, I use a 821H and does not have a have default option for tone and hence I generate the tone using a software called "ComTekk" in my PC and the audio is fed to the ACC socket on the 821H .

>Yes, the ICOM IC-821 will do sub-audible tone when transmitting in satellite mode. I use it for SO-50.
>
>I think the trick is to program the tone in a satellite memory, then recall that memory channel before letting SatPC32 control the transmit and receive frequencies.
>
>Selecting the tone frequency and enabling the tone can't be done via CAT CI-V commands on the IC-821.
